Kinetic Dog Training Agility, Rally O, Nosework, Tricks and Games, Disc and Freestyle training. Dana trains using only scientifically proven, positive reinforcement-based methods.

Dana Gallagher is a certified professional dog trainer (CPDT-KA), a Karen Pryor Academy Certified Training Partner (KPA-CTP), a Certified Nose Work Instructor (CNWI) and member of the President's Choice International Superdogs Performance Team. Dana is the owner of Kinetic Dog Training, specializing in behavior modification and dog sports. Vancouver born and raised, Dana worked in public relations

and communications before following her dream of working with people and their dogs, which she has happily done since 2001. As part of her professional continuing education, Dana continues to take seminars and workshops from leaders in their respective fields. In addition to teaching and training, Dana volunteers her time with various canine rescue groups as a foster home and behavioral consultant. She also volunteers with her dogs doing pet therapy at a senior's residence, does demos with The Paws Squad, and as part of the BC SPCA Bite Safe program. She has adopted all but one of her own dogs from private rescues and animal shelters. Dana's dogs have collectively trained in agility, rally obedience, flyball, nosework, musical freestyle, tracking, carting, herding, obedience, and freestyle flying disc.

We are soooo excited to officially share our handout on the Stages of Training. Thank you Doggie Drawings by Lili Chin for bringing this to life! This handout is used for clients to follow their dog's training progress!
It goes through all the stages of learning:
1. Acquisition (get the behavior)
2. Fluency (add the cue)
3. Generalization (proof the behavior)
4. Maintenance (maintain the behavior)
